Eduardo Badía Serra is a distinguished Salvadoran academic and former rector of the University of El Salvador, known for his commitment to education and social transformation. With a background in both chemistry and history, Badía has played a vital role in advocating for academic excellence and addressing social injustices in El Salvador. His contributions to the field of industrial chemistry and his leadership during turbulent political times have solidified his legacy as a key figure in the country's intellectual community.
